Book Synopsis

This atlas is a practical guide to the diagnosis of common retina and optic nerve disorders.

Comprising more than 500 archetypal images, each disease is clearly illustrated showing clinical features and signs, from its early to later stages.

The images are followed by a brief description highlighting key characteristics of the disease, providing clinicians with a comprehensive overview and enabling them to diagnose ocular conditions with ease.

Divided into 15 sections, the book begins with an introduction to the ‘normal’ fundus. The following sections examine different retinal disorders, from retinal degeneration, uveitis, and infections, to traumatic chorioretinopathy and optic disc anomalies.

The atlas concludes with chapters on ocular oncology and complications of surgery.

A complete section is dedicated to paediatric retinal diseases.
